Types of Hobs and Extractor Hoods

Before diving into comparisons, it is vital to understand the kinds of hobs and extractor hoods available.

Hobs

  1. Gas Hobs: Operate utilizing natural gas or propane, offering immediate heat and temperature level control.
  2. Electric Hobs: Include conventional coil burners and smooth ceramic glass options.
  3. Induction Hobs: Use electromagnetism to straight heat pots and pans, reducing heat loss and improving efficiency.
  4. Dual Fuel Hobs: Combine a gas hob with an electric oven, offering adaptability in cooking.

Extractor Hoods

  1. Wall-Mounted Hoods: These hoods are connected to the wall above the hob and are popular for their timeless style.
  2. Island Hoods: Ideal for cooking area islands, these hoods hang from the ceiling, using an elegant focal point.
  3. Under-Cabinet Hoods: Mounted under cabinets, they save space while providing effective ventilation.
  4. Downdraft Hoods: Integrated into the hob, these retractable hoods trigger when cooking begins.

Secret Features to Consider

When selecting a hob and extractor hood combination, certain crucial functions ought to be taken into account:

  1. Suction Power: Measured in cubic meters per hour (m ³/ h), this shows how well the hood can aerate. Look for a minimum of 400 m ³/ h for reliable removal of smoke and odors.
  2. Size: Ensure that the extractor hood is the ideal size for your hob.  Geschirrspüler Mit Zeolith Trocknung  is to have a hood that is at least as wide as the hob.
  3. Sound Level: Measured in decibels (dB), the noise level can significantly impact the kitchen area environment. A quieter option (under 55 dB) is frequently preferable, especially during extended cooking durations.
  4. Energy Efficiency: Look for designs with energy-efficient rankings to minimize electricity costs and be more environmentally friendly.
  5. Filters: Consider whether you desire a ducted (completely linked to the outdoors) or recirculated (uses filters) extractor system. Stainless-steel filters are easy to tidy and preserve.

FREQUENTLY ASKED QUESTION:

1. Do I require an extractor hood with an induction hob?

Yes, an extractor hood is advantageous for an induction hob to eliminate cooking smells and keep air quality.

2. How typically should I clean the filters in my extractor hood?

Filters need to be cleaned up when a month or as often as required based on your cooking frequency.

3. Are downdraft hoods as reliable as standard hoods?

Downdraft hoods can be effective but may not offer as much suction power compared to conventional hoods.

4. What is the ideal height for mounting an extractor hood?

Usually, wall-mounted hoods ought to be 24-30 inches above the cooking surface, while island hoods typically need 30-36 inches.

5. Can I set up an extractor hood myself?

While some people may go with DIY setup, it is advised to work with an expert to ensure security and correct function.
